本站所有资源均为高质量资源,各种姿势下载。
数字PID控制在自动化控制领域中扮演着重要角色,其稳定性强、实现简单的特性使其成为工业控制系统的标配算法。Matlab作为工程计算领域的常用工具,能够帮助我们快速实现和验证PID控制算法。
数字PID控制的核心在于三个参数的调节:比例项Kp、积分项Ki和微分项Kd。这三个参数分别对应系统响应的当前误差、历史误差累计和未来误差趋势。通过合理设置这三个参数,可以实现系统快速响应且稳定的控制效果。
在实现过程中,采样时间的选择尤为关键,它决定了控制系统的响应速度和控制精度之间的平衡。采样时间过短会导致计算资源浪费,过长则可能错过重要的系统动态响应。
数字PID算法的实现还涉及积分抗饱和和微分平滑处理等工程实践技巧,这些措施能有效避免积分项导致的系统超调和微分项引入的高频噪声问题。